Introduction This lovely, end of terrace cottage, originally built circa. 1856 is situated in the heart of Netley village, close to local schools, shops and amenities. Offered in excellent condition throughout with lovely features including Oak and Teak flooring, plantation style shutters and two feature fireplaces. Accommodation comprises a welcoming entrance hall, living room, large reception room, re-fitted kitchen/breakfast room, two double bedrooms and well-appointed family bathroom. Outside there is a block paved driveway, garage and wonderful enclosed garden to the rear.

Location Victoria Road is conveniently located less than a mile from the Royal Victoria Country Park, comprising 200 acres of grassed parkland and woodland with a network of lovely walks on the doorstep. The village of Netley has pubs, a church and several green spaces along with two busy sailing clubs.

Hamble and its marinas, broad range of pubs, restaurants and waterfront are only minutes away, with all main motorway access links also being close by enabling easy access to Southampton, Portsmouth, Winchester, Chichester, Guildford and London.
